Output 940fe6deac108f8d92dd7efa321fdc14df84e308668d3ce7fa642bb6d1c0eda9:27

value
7960627
script pubkey
OP_0 OP_PUSHBYTES_20 ba81ee1e485b44fa7e41b9d4d1dec4e4f4fb4a44
address
bc1qh2q7u8jgtdz05ljph82drhkyun60kjjysdc62m
transaction
940fe6deac108f8d92dd7efa321fdc14df84e308668d3ce7fa642bb6d1c0eda9
spent
true